Chomsky Normal Form : Grammatical Terms in Linguistics
54 words, approx. 1 pages
// n. The form of a context-free grammar in which every rule is either of the form A BC or of the form Aa, where A, B and C are non-terminals and a is a terminal. For every context-free grammar there is a weakly equivalent grammar in this form. Chomsky...
